: The base of a closed rectangular box has length equal to 3 times its width, which is w inches; its height is 6 in. less than its width. Express the surface area, S, of the box as a function of w.

First off, draw a rectangular solid on a piece of paper.
Label the sides L, W, and H.
Now calculate the surface area.
You should get contributions from the LW face of 2*LW, the LH face of 2*LH, and the WH face of 2*WH.
SA=2LW%2B2LH%2B2WH
SA=2%28LW%2BLH%2BWH%29
Now to the measurements,
Length = 3*Width=3*W, L=3W
Width = W
Height=Width-6=W-6, H=W-6
Go back to the surface area equation and substitute,
SA=2%28LW%2BLH%2BWH%29
SA=2%283W%2AW%2B3W%28W-6%29%2BW%28W-6%29%29
SA=2%283W%5E2%2B3W%5E2-18W%2BW%5E2-6W%29%29
SA=2%287W%5E2-24W%29%29
SA=14W%5E2-48W%29
